Maryland’s Cybersecurity Scene: Not Just Crab Cakes Anymore

For years, Maryland has been quietly building a name for itself in the cybersecurity industry. It makes sense, really. You’ve got Fort Meade lurking nearby, home to the US Cyber Command and the National Security Agency – basically, the epicentre of digital defence in the States. All that government and military presence has created a fertile ground for cybersecurity startups to sprout up, like mushrooms after a good rain. And sprout they have. We’re seeing a real boom in Maryland cybersecurity startups, and it’s not just happening by accident. There’s serious investment flowing in, and a real sense of momentum.

Post-Quantum Cryptography: Bracing for the Quantum Leap

As if AI wasn’t enough to chew on, there’s another looming threat on the horizon: quantum computing. Now, quantum computers are still largely in the realm of science fiction for most of us, but their potential impact on cybersecurity is anything but fictional. These super-powered machines could, in theory, crack current encryption methods like a toddler smashing biscuits. Suddenly, all our carefully constructed digital walls could crumble. Charming, isn’t it?

This is where post-quantum cryptography (PQC) comes into play. It’s the boffins’ answer to the quantum threat, developing new encryption techniques that are designed to withstand even the most powerful quantum computers. And guess what? Maryland is also becoming a place with growing activity in post-quantum cryptography startups. These are the folks working on the digital locks of the future, ensuring that when quantum computers finally arrive in force, our secrets remain safe. It’s a long game, this quantum stuff, but cybersecurity innovation in this area is absolutely vital, and Maryland is positioning itself right at the forefront.
